### Why autocomplete feels slow

The Pinewhistle suggest index rebuilds on every tenant write, which is overkill and also why p95 crawls during bulk imports. From a security angle, nothing sensitive leaks — suggestions are scoped per tenant before ranking. The fix is batching rebuilds behind a debounce window. Here are the knobs we're proposing.

tuning table, fawip-fahag:
WEIGHTS = {
    "novwyn": 452,
    "casdor": 675,
}

Subject: Gross-Margin Review — Q3

Team,

Margins on the Veltrix line slipped 2.1 points last quarter. Freight and rework at the Brennard plant are the main drivers. Each department head: bring a one-page mitigation plan to Thursday's session. No extensions.

Marta Quill has compiled the underlying figures. The strategic context is summarized in the confidential note below.

internal memo for yahag-hahig: Belwynix Group plans to lower the Silir list price by 62 percent in May.

// PAGE_SIZE_MAX for the Ferrowick public REST API.
// Plugins must not request more than this per call; the
// gateway clamps silently rather than erroring, so check
// response lengths. Cursors expire after ten minutes —
// don't cache them across sessions. If your plugin sees
// truncated pages, compare against this constant before
// filing a report. The gateway build that enforces this
// clamp is stamped with the token below.

trace token, fafog-kageg: htk4_98e6